Resume

Measles is a controlled infection. The incidence rate depends on the effectiveness of the vaccination. Due to various vaccine prevention problems, measles is still a common disease in many parts of the world, including Europe, the Middle East, Asia, the Pacific and Africa. It is becoming one of the leading causes of death that could be prevented by vaccination. Most children under the age of five suffer from this infection. To prevent the incidence of measles, it is necessary to ensure that at least 95% of the population receives the first and second doses of the vaccine.
